This website requires JavaScript.
入驻
发布

暖心杯垫

荷塘机电 发布于2024-01-30 17:49:34 CC BY-NC协议 分类:智能家居 侵权投诉
销量: 6
9
11
0
简介:

一个确保安全的办公室或居家使用的自动加热散热杯垫,在冬天可以通过加热使茶水相对温暖,在夏天通过风扇散热加速茶水的冷却。屏幕自带OLED显示屏、NTC温度传感器和热释电传感器,可以选择自动或手动控制,并实时显示杯垫的温度和状态。产品带有wifi或蓝牙天线。

应用场景:

办公室或居家使用的加热或散热杯垫,也可以作为DIY的开发板来使用,例如加热的PID控制、热释电温度感应的采集等。

 一、产品简介

一个确保安全的办公室或居家使用的自动加热散热杯垫,在冬天可以通过加热使茶水相对温暖,在夏天通过风扇散热加速茶水的冷却。屏幕自带OLED显示屏、NTC温度传感器和热释电传感器,可以选择自动或手动控制,并实时显示杯垫的温度和状态。产品带有wifi或蓝牙天线。


二、应用场景

办公室或居家使用的加热或散热杯垫,也可以作为DIY的开发板来使用,例如加热的PID控制、热释电温度感应的采集等。


三、产品概述

1. 杯垫使用W801-C400作为主控芯片,该芯片芯片集成XT804处理器,工作频率240MHz,2MB Flash ,288KB RAM,有4路ADC和5路PWM,自带WiFi和蓝牙。

2. 使用0.96寸的OLED屏和3个按键作为人机交互的显示和输入。

3. 杯垫内部有2路测量发热盘温度的NTC传感器。

4. 杯垫侧面安装有红外对射传感器,用于检测杯垫上是否有杯子。

5. 侧面同时安装有热释电传感器,可以用来辅助检测杯子温度。

6. 杯垫底部安装有加热功能的电热丝。

7. 杯垫底部同时安装有散热功能的微型风扇,在杯垫四周内圈有整圈的辅助散热孔。


四、产品参数

1. 使用TypeC接口5V2A供电,直接使用标准的充电插头就可以使用。

2. 杯垫的发热盘使用标准的14.5欧/米的电热丝直接绕制到PCB底层,杯子放置在PCB的另一面。

3. 发热盘分前、中、后三路独立控制供电,每路的电流控制在0.7安以内,避免温度过高,确保安全。

4. 发热盘的前和后都独立安装了NTC温度传感器,实时监测发热盘的温度,避免温度过高。

5. 杯垫底部安装有微型散热风扇,同时在杯垫外壳内圈有一圈对流孔,用于给茶杯加速散热用。

6. OLED显示器的分辨率为128*64,单色,SPI接口。

7. 显示器上方有3个轻触按钮,用于人机交互。

8. 加热和散热都可以工作在自动或手动状态。

9. 内部设定自动控制温度为摄氏50度。

10. 内部设定的自动预警温度是55度,发热盘温度到达预警温度,将自动开启风扇强制散热。

11. 内部设定的危险温度是60度,到达危险温度将强制关闭发热盘电源,并开启风扇散热,同时OLED屏闪烁。

预警温度和危险温度的设置也是确保杯垫的安全其中一个措施。

下面是设计和实物图片

  1. PCB的3D图

发热盘的背面

暖心杯垫硬件项目图1



发热盘正面

暖心杯垫硬件项目图2


五、使用说明

A、杯垫功能使用说明

杯垫具有加热和散热功能,可以独立工作,也可以配合工作,屏幕会实时显示杯垫的工作状态和发热盘温度。

1. 屏幕上方有3个按钮,其中左边的按钮是停止按钮,中间的是加热功能选择按钮,右边的是散热功能选择按钮。

2. 杯垫加热可以选择:自动状态、仅仅中间加热、两侧加热、全功率加热、停止加热,共5种状态。

3. 杯垫散热可以选择:自动状态、散热开启、散热停止,共3种状态。

4. 加热和散热独立或配合工作。当加热和散热都选择自动时,发热盘温度到达自动控制的温度(50度)时,将自动开启风扇进行散热。

5. 在自动状态时,如果检测到杯垫有杯子,将会全功率加热杯垫,直到杯垫到达自动控制温度值后才关闭相应侧的电热丝。如果杯垫没有杯子,温度到达自动控制温度后,将会只保留杯垫中间部位的电热丝加热,两侧的电热丝会自动关闭。

6. 考虑杯垫会放在床头,晚上屏幕太亮影响休息,做了延时一段时间自动关闭大部分灯光的功能。

7. 杯垫具有wifi和蓝牙功能,内部天线已安装好,源代码有相应的演示代码,目前尚未深入开发具体应用。


B、项目说明

该杯垫是在厂家给出的demo程序下直接增加OLED 中文显示和杯垫逻辑控制代码做出的。厂家的demo里有比较完善的测试代码,包括wifi、蓝牙、PWM、ADC等等,复制本项目后可以在这基础上开发自己的各类功能测试。供电的TypeC接口同时也是W801芯片的串口数据输入输出接口和固件下载更新接口。

1. 源代码在CDK(C-SKY Development Kit)的环境编译。

2. 下载工具使用厂家给出的Upgrade_Tools_V1.4.18.exe。

3. 原厂的demo程序基本没有做修改,原有的所有功能适当修改端口是可以编译运行的。

4. PCB上已经集成了WiFi和蓝牙天线,经demo程序测试过可以使用。

5. 代码移植了厂家(可能是)给的OLED显示驱动SSD1306为SSD1315,基本没什么改动。

6. 利用MCU有2M flash的优势,移植了16*16点阵的中文软字库集成到系统里,并编写了输出代码。

7. 热释电传感器的温度测量值与环境温度相关性太大,手上没有可以使用的对应数据表,所以只在屏幕做了实时显示当前放大后的热释电输出电压的显示,单位是mV。

8. 杯垫在Free CAD下做了3D外壳设计,可以直接3D打印。

9. 杯垫传感器和人机界面位置图

暖心杯垫硬件项目图3

暖心杯垫硬件项目图4


10.工作界面图

暖心杯垫硬件项目图5


11.焊盘中标记LCxx的焊盘是用于固定电热丝的,我用的是扁丝,用园丝也可以。

暖心杯垫硬件项目图6


 六、备注

暖心杯垫的安装过程的参考可以在抖音搜关键词 "荷塘机电“,上面有整个开发过程的视频。

暖心杯垫的电热丝可以直接在某宝购买 14欧/米 至 15欧/米 的电热丝,大概使用长度是2米,我用的1mm*0.1mm的扁丝,大家也可以用直径0.6以下的电热丝。

附件包含有源码、固件、烧录工具、焊接辅助工具、外壳文件。

整个暖心杯垫的元件成本大概50元。


七、测试视频

1. 杯垫上电过程视频

上电过程会展示暖心杯垫的名称和简易的使用说明。



2. 杯垫菜单视频

视频展示了暖心杯垫的菜单结构和按键操作进入的方法。


单片机 办公用品
最近更新时间 2024-01-30 17:49:34
描述
PCB
元件清单
原理图
附件
讨论